Job overview
The Director of Veterinary Management at UMBC is responsible for clinical veterinary care and oversight of research animal health and well-being, reporting to the Dean of the College of Natural and Mathematical Sciences.
Responsibilities and impact
Key responsibilities include providing veterinary medical care, maintaining regulatory compliance, supervising staff, and participating in protocol monitoring and development of animal husbandry SOPs.
Compensation and benefits
The salary starts at $127,000, commensurate with qualifications and experience, and the position is full-time with exempt status.
Experience and skills
Candidates must have a Doctor of Veterinary Medicine (DVM) degree, a current veterinary license, and a minimum of two years of laboratory animal clinical experience, along with strong communication and management skills.

Company overview
The University of Maryland Baltimore County (UMBC) is a public research university known for its strong emphasis on science, engineering, information technology, and liberal arts programs. It generates revenue through tuition, research grants, and partnerships with industry leaders. Founded in 1966, UMBC has a history of fostering innovation and inclusivity, with notable achievements in cybersecurity and data science. The university is also recognized for its diverse student body and commitment to community engagement.
